ตัวอย่าง
หาวิธีหลาย <area> องค์ประกอบที่มีอยู่ในภาพแผนที่ที่เฉพาะเจาะจง:
var x = document.getElementById("planetmap").areas.length;
ผลของ x จะเป็น:
3
ลองตัวเอง» เพิ่มเติม "Try it Yourself" ตัวอย่างด้านล่าง
ความหมายและการใช้งาน
คอลเลกชันพื้นที่ผลตอบแทนของคอลเลกชันทั้งหมด <area> องค์ประกอบในภาพแผนที่
Note: องค์ประกอบในคอลเลกชันจะถูกเรียงลำดับตามที่ปรากฏในรหัสที่มา
Tip: การกลับมาของคอลเลกชันทั้งหมด <area> องค์ประกอบที่มีแอตทริบิวต์ href ระบุใช้ การเชื่อมโยง คอลเลกชัน
สนับสนุนเบราว์เซอร์
ชุด | |||||
---|---|---|---|---|---|
areas | ใช่ | ใช่ | ใช่ | ใช่ | ใช่ |
วากยสัมพันธ์
mapObject .areas
คุณสมบัติ
คุณสมบัติ | ลักษณะ |
---|---|
length | แสดงจำนวนของ <area> องค์ประกอบในคอลเลกชัน หมายเหตุ: คุณสมบัตินี้ถูกอ่านอย่างเดียว |
วิธีการ
วิธี | ลักษณะ |
---|---|
[ index ] | ส่งคืน <area> องค์ประกอบจากคอลเลกชันที่มีดัชนีที่ระบุ (starts at 0) หมายเหตุ: คืน null หากหมายเลขดัชนีอยู่นอกช่วง |
item( index ) | ส่งคืน <area> องค์ประกอบจากคอลเลกชันที่มีดัชนีที่ระบุ (starts at 0) หมายเหตุ: คืน null หากหมายเลขดัชนีอยู่นอกช่วง |
namedItem( id ) | ส่งคืน <area> องค์ประกอบจากคอลเลกชันที่มี ID ที่ระบุ หมายเหตุ: คืน null หากประชาชนไม่ได้อยู่ |
รายละเอียดทางเทคนิค
DOM เวอร์ชัน: | ระดับแกนวัตถุ 2 เอกสาร |
---|---|
กลับค่า: | วัตถุ HTMLCollection คิดเป็นทั้งหมด <area> องค์ประกอบในภาพแผนที่ในเอกสาร องค์ประกอบในการเก็บรวบรวมจะถูกเรียงลำดับตามที่ปรากฏในรหัสที่มา |
ตัวอย่างอื่น ๆ
ตัวอย่าง
[ดัชนี]
รับ URL ของแรก <area> องค์ประกอบในภาพแผนที่:
var x = document.getElementById("planetmap").areas[0].href;
ผลของ x จะเป็น:
http://www.w3ii.com/jsref/sun.htm
ลองตัวเอง» ตัวอย่าง
item( index )
รับ URL ของแรก <area> องค์ประกอบในภาพแผนที่:
var x = document.getElementById("planetmap").areas.item(0).href;
ผลของ x จะเป็น:
http://www.w3ii.com/jsref/sun.htm
ลองตัวเอง» ตัวอย่าง
namedItem( id )
รับ URL ของ <area> องค์ประกอบที่มี id = "myArea" ในภาพแผนที่:
var x = document.getElementById("planetmap").areas.namedItem("myArea").href;
ผลของ x จะเป็น:
http://www.w3ii.com/jsref/mercur.htm
ลองตัวเอง» ตัวอย่าง
ห่วงผ่านทั้งหมด <area> องค์ประกอบในภาพแผนที่และผลผลิตรูปร่างของแต่ละพื้นที่:
var x = document.getElementById("planetmap");
var txt = "";
var i;
for (i =
0; i < x.areas.length; i++) {
txt = txt + x.areas[i].shape
+ "<br>";
}
ผลจากการ txt จะเป็น:
rect
circle
circle
ลองตัวเอง» <แผนที่วัตถุ